Djokovic angrily confronts fan after being heckled in warm up at US Open

NOVAK DJOKOVIC angrily confronted fan after being heckled in the warm up at the US Open.

The world No1, 32, was warming up for his third-round match with American ace Denis Kudla when he flipped after a comment from the crowd.

In his pre-match practice, Djok pulled out of hitting a serve to storm over to the fan, starting a heated confrontation.

It's unknown what the supporter said to rile him up - and Djokovic's initial reply.

But as he walked back to his mark, the 16-time Grand Slam champion warned: “I’ll come find you. Trust me, I’ll come find you.”

As is often the way with Djokovic, he stepped up a level on the court following the confrontation.

The Serbian ace thumped home-hero Kidla in straight-sets, 6-3 6-4 6-2 to reach the fourth round.

Djokovic had already beaten Juan Iganacio Londero and Roberto Carballes Baena without dropping a set.

He will now take on Stanislas Wawrinka - the US Open champion in 2016 for a place in the quarter-finals.
